Can anyone tell if this is hand or machine set? by No_Zebra131 in jewelers

[–]FAPTROCITY 34 points35 points  (0 children)

This is technically set by hand but it’s called preset.

The setting and claws were made in CAD. The setter just shoves stones in.

This is not hand drilled and prepared. The claws would look smaller. The edge would have a bright cut, not a small solid edge like the photo above does. The best way to think of it is, the metal has a surface and the claws were pulled up to hold the stones.

Professional/ well done pave work, the stones replace / go into/under the surface . The claws are all the metal that’s left over after all of the prep work has been done.

Also who ever did the CAD layout didn’t do this layout properly. They just put three rows in it, the didn’t stagger/honeycomb it.

Very little thinking in the execution

Half marathon on Keto by Empty-Race1663 in ketoendurance

[–]FAPTROCITY 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Replace magnesium citrate for bisglycinate.

Try less “salt” use a half salt that has some potassium instead of all sodium chloride.

Magnesium citrate and larger amounts of sodium chloride pull water in to your GI.

Hydrate hour prior to the run. Half the dose for hydration during the run.

Try a very low to no insulin spike carb. (Cluster Dextrin (or Highly Branched Cyclic Dextrin - HBCD)
